Resident Evil for Dreamcast.
https://www.twingalaxies.com/resident-evil/sega-dreamcast

This game doesn't exist for DC.
DC versions are:
- Resident Evil CODE: Veronica
- Resident Evil 2
- Resident Evil 3: Nemesis

Probably who created this variation intended to track
Resident Evil CODE: Veronica game. All the rules for the 4 variations on the TG database are fine for CODE: Veronica.
The field "rules" should be more detailed in my opinion, but the titles of the variations cover it (for example, Rocket Launcher).

There are zero submissions in the database.

Cyborg Justice (Genesis).

TG database has a Cyborg Hunter variation for Genesis, however, Cyborg Hunter is a Master System game that doesn't have score and doesn't have options.

The Genesis game with scores and options is a different game: Cyborg Justice. The rules are fine.

Please edit this gamename from Cyborg Hunter to Cyborg Justice:
https://www.twingalaxies.com/cyborg-hunter/sega-genesis-sega-mega-drive

Galaga 3 High Score Challenge
(3 Lives to start)
Dip-Switch Bank A:

1-8 = OFF



Dip-Switch Bank B:

1-5 = OFF

6-8 = ON



Note: The above Dip Switches, are not only the FACTORY DEFAULT settings, but are also the correct Twin Galaxies Tournament Settings for this title and will provide the following settings;

3 Fighters

Difficulty 0 - Standard Level of Play

Bonus Ships Awarded: 1st @ 30,000; 2nd @ 150,000 & every 150,000



Note: The manual for Gaplus/Galaga 3 shows the default setting to give extra lives at 30k, 150k, and every 600k thereafter. This setting does not exist and the game cannot be set to such settings.

When the dip switches are put to the default positions, they give extra ships at the shown settings above (every 150k) which also matches settings for home console versions of Gaplus for the PlayStation and Nintendo Wii as well as the test screen example shown in the manual on page 4. It is believed that the manual lists settings for a pre-release version of the game and was not updated upon release.
